  • »Designed for high-performance computing applications requiring the processing power of Quad-core Intel® Xeon® Quad-core processors
  • »Maximum memory bandwidth via a four-channel DDR2-667 memory interface
  • »Server-Class SHB with two PCI-Express x8 lanes and one PCIe x4 lane supports backplane card slots and I/O
  • »Coupled with a Trenton backplane, this SHB can support PCIe, PCI-X, or PCI option cards
  • »Stable long-life product cycle and reliable five-year warranty
  • »PICMG 1.3 system host board with on-board SATA II RAID, video, USB, Gigabit Ethernet ports
  • »Product is designed, manufactured and supported by Trenton at our U. S. facilities

FORM FACTOR

PICMG 1.3 Server Class (PCI Express links= two x8 and one x4 or four x1)

PROCESSORS

Two Quad-Core Intel® Xeon® Processors - 5400 series with 1333MHz FSB, 2x6MB L2 cache
Two Quad-Core Intel® Xeon® Processors - 5300 series with 1333MHz FSB, 2x4MB L2 cache

*other processor options are available with non-embedded support

BIOS (FLASH)

AMI - AMIBIOS® 8

CHIPSET

Intel® 5000P with the Intel® 6321 ESB I/O Controller Hub

MEMORY

32GB (max), four-channel Fully Buffered DIMM (FBDIMM) DDR2-667 interface with eight sockets

VIDEO INTERFACE

ATI® ES1000, 16MB memory, 1280 x 1024 resolution (SXGA)

ETHERNET INTERFACES

Intel® 82563EB Ethernet controller - Two 10/100/1000Base-T on I/O Bracket Connectors
Intel® 82563E  Ethernet controller - One 10/100/1000Base-T interface routed to SHB edge connector "C"

ON-BOARD INTERFACES

Eight USB 2.0 ports - Two each on the I/O bracket and on-board headers plus four routed to SHB edge connector "C"

Six SATA II/300 interfaces with RAID 0,1,5 and 10 support

One Ultra/ATA 100 support

WATCHDOG TIMER

MAX6369 from Maxim® Integrated Products - Four watchdog timer reset ranges from 100 msec to 3 minutes

BATTERY

Lithium - CMOS data retention

MECHANICAL

Board dimensions – 13.330” (33.86cm) L x 5.726” (14.54”cm) H  
Standard cooling solution height range – 2.77” (70.36mm) to 2.92” (74.24mm)
Low-Profile cooling solution height range – 2.38” (60.45mm) to 2.53” (64.34mm)

AGENCY APPROVALS & COMPLIANCE

UL60950, CAN/CSA C22.2 No. 60950-00, EN55022:1998 Class B, EN61000-4-2:1995,
EN61000-4-3:1997, EN61000-4-4:1995, EN61000-4-5:1995, EN61000-4-6:1996:
EN61000-4-11:1994

MEAN TIME BETWEEN FAILURES (MTBF)

MTBF = 186,261 Power-On Hours (POH) at 40° C per Bellcore

BP4FS6890

The BP4FS6890 is a four segment backplane, 20-slot form factor that can be configured for graphics- or server-class applications. The BP4FS6890 backplane supports four system host boards, eight x16 and four x8 PCI Express option card slots.


IOB32

This optional, plug-in module is available in two models and both versions can be used to enable Trusted Platform Module or TPM functionality in a system using a Trenton PICMG 1.3 system host board. The IOB32 provides TPM 1.2 functionality when used with a Trenton TQ9 SHB or any model of Trenton's MCX- or MCG-series of SHBs.


IOB31

Plugs into the controlled impedance connector on Trenton's PICMG 1.3 system host boards to provide I/O and PCI Express expansion capability on backplanes equipped with a PCI Express Expansion slot. On-board IOB31 connector headers support two serial ports, a parallel port, PS/2 mouse and keyboard connections and a floppy port.


IOB30MC

Plugs into the controlled impedance connector on Trenton's PICMG 1.3 system host boards to provide I/O expansion capability for two serial ports, a parallel port, PS/2 mouse and keyboard connections and a floppy port. Use the IOB30MC version with MCX/MCG-series or TQ9 SHBs.
